Radiator Covers are a perfect cover for any eye catching radiator in a home. When looking in a room, does the radiator catch the eye before anything else in the room? If this is the case now is the time to build a radiator cover.
The first thing a person would want to do when building radiator covers is too have the tools they will need and material that is needed to build one.
Do the measurements of the radiator before doing anything to have an idea of the proper size. The height of the radiator and then add one inch to the top to allow air flow. Measure the depths again leaving enough room about an inch and same with the depths of the radiator. The importance of the inch is to have proper air flow and placement of the radiator covers on radiators.
Next decide what type of wood to build radiator covers. Popular knot free wood is recommended for radiator covers. Popular is easy to work with and does fit easier when putting together. A person will only need to purchase enough wood for sides, top, and edging. The back will be open with the front having a special grill.
The grill can be made of wood or metal. This will need to be purchase to fit the front panel on the radiator covers.
Glue, claps, saws, drill, hammer, nails or wood screws will need to be purchased to attach and build the radiator covers.
